Xagomax Font Review

As a small business owner who loves crafting and designing, I've tested Xagomax on everything from candle labels to digital printables. This bold and authentic display font has quickly become a go-to for my shop's branding needs. With its clean sans serif structure and striking personality, Xagomax brings a modern edge to handmade products and creative projects.

Xagomax for Bold Branding and Eye-Catching Labels

When I first tried Xagomax on a candle label, I was immediately struck by how it elevated the design. The font’s sharp edges and strong presence make it perfect for product labels that need to stand out on shelves or in online listings. I used it for a "Natural Soy Candle" label, and the result was crisp, professional, and instantly recognizable. For any handmade seller looking to make their packaging pop, Xagomax is an excellent choice.

One of the best things about Xagomax is its versatility. It works well with both minimalist and maximalist designs, and its boldness doesn’t overpower other elements. Whether paired with a simple background or layered with illustrations, it adds a sense of energy and style that’s hard to match with other fonts.

Xagomax for T-Shirt Printing and Merchandise Design

I recently designed a t-shirt for a local gaming event, and Xagomax was the perfect fit. Its gaming-inspired aesthetic gave the design a competitive edge while keeping it legible at a distance. I used it for the main text on the back of the shirt, and it looked great whether printed in black or colored ink. The font’s clean lines also made it easy to cut with my Cricut machine, which is a big plus for anyone using vinyl or heat transfer materials.

For merchandise like tote bags and mugs, Xagomax maintains its clarity and impact without looking too flashy. It’s ideal for short phrases like "Game On" or "Play Hard," and it pairs well with other fonts when needed. If you're creating custom apparel or accessories, this font can help you make a strong visual statement without overcomplicating your design.

Xagomax for Digital Printables and Creative Templates

As someone who creates printable wall art and planner pages, I appreciate how Xagomax performs in digital formats. It looks sharp on screen and prints clearly at high resolutions. I used it for a set of seasonal greeting cards, and the font added a dynamic feel that matched the festive theme. Whether used for headings or decorative elements, Xagomax brings a sense of creativity and professionalism to any printable project.

One thing to keep in mind is that Xagomax is best suited for short text. While it’s beautiful as a logo or title, it may not be the best choice for long paragraphs or dense information. That said, it shines when used as a focal point, making it ideal for headers, captions, and decorative wording in digital templates.

Xagomax for Packaging and Shop Listings

When I updated my shop listings, I incorporated Xagomax into the product titles and descriptions. The font’s boldness helped draw attention to key details, and it gave my listings a more polished look. I also used it for a mockup preview of a new product box, and it looked great alongside my other design elements.

For packaging, Xagomax adds a premium feel without being too loud. It works well on both simple and elaborate designs, and its readability makes it practical for product tags and instructions. If you’re looking to elevate your shop’s visual identity, this font can help create a cohesive and professional brand image.

Xagomax for Wedding Invitations and Elegant Stationery

Although Xagomax has a gaming vibe, it also works surprisingly well for more elegant designs. I used it for a wedding invitation header, and it added a modern twist to the traditional layout. The font’s clean lines and strong presence made it easy to pair with a classic serif font for the body text, resulting in a balanced and stylish design.

For stationery like thank-you cards and bridal shower invitations, Xagomax offers a fresh alternative to more conventional fonts. It’s especially effective when used sparingly, allowing the rest of the design to shine while still maintaining a strong visual identity.
